### Scanner Integration Setup

New hires configuring the Bramblepoint warehouse app: the handheld scanners talk to our Scanbridge service over local Wi-Fi. Set SCANBRIDGE_HOST to the depot gateway and SCAN_DEBOUNCE_MS to 250 to avoid duplicate reads. Scanbridge authenticates every device session against the inventory API, and the API credential it uses belongs on the very next line.

secret setting of hawep-yahig: LEDGER_TOKEN29=41b5d6315371c92885eaeb077fb63

TURN-208: Gatevale turnstile counters at the Merrow Field pilot double-count when a rotation reverses mid-cycle. Attendance totals drift roughly 2% high per event. The debounce window fix is implemented, reviewed by Ilsa, and soak-tested across two simulated match days without drift. Ready for your cut; the candidate build is identified below.

trace token, tagag-tafog: htk6_5ed18c

## Step 4: Update tailcat settings

Almost there! The new tailcat CLI (Bramblehook build) drops the old plaintext transport, so your log-tailing sessions are now mTLS-only — the reviewers asked for this, and honestly it was overdue. Before running `tailcat verify`, make sure your local profile matches the sanctioned setup. The expected configuration values are as follows.

config for kafof-bawef:
holath:
  log_level: debug
  metrics_host: metrics.holath.qorvelsys.internal
  pin: 2191
  pool_size: 32

Step 3: Register the ParcelPath webhook. New folks: the webhook is how Dromond Logistics pushes tracking events into our pipeline, replacing the old polling job. First, confirm the receiver endpoint is deployed and passing health checks — events arrive within seconds of a carrier scan, so the consumer must be up before registration. Signature verification is mandatory; unsigned payloads are dropped. Once the receiver is live, register it using the configuration values listed below.

settings of kajep-kawip:
[zorys]
host = zorys.urlaqgrid.corp
user = zorys_svc
database = zorys_prod